The concert ended as it began, with the school choir taking to the stage a second time to perform the beautiful Starlight Carol. This was followed by a rousing rendition of Jingle Bell Rock. |
A collection was taken to raise money for school funds. The prize of a huge teddy bear was available to one lucky member of the audience. Instead of a raffle, there was a golden ticket hidden under one of the chairs. |
